.middleup
{
	background-image:url(../Images/bg_popup_pixel_up.gif);
	background-repeat:repeat-x;
}
.middledown
{
	background-image:url(../Images/bg_popup_pixel_down.gif);
	background-repeat:repeat-x;
}
.rightside 
{
		background-image:url(../Images/bg_popup_pixel_right.gif);
	background-repeat:repeat-y;
}

.leftside
{
	background-image:url(../Images/bg_popup_pixel_left.gif);
	background-repeat:repeat-y;
}
.thumbnail
{
border:solid 1px black;
position: relative;
border:none;
z-index: 50;
display:none;
}
.thumbnail span
{ 
position: absolute;
padding: 5px;
visibility: hidden;
text-decoration: none;
}

.thumbnail span img
{ 
border-width: 0;
padding: 2px;
}

.thumbnail_click
{ 
visibility: visible;
position: absolute;
top:400px;
left:300px;
text-decoration: none;
z-index:999;
}

div.BrandSeacrhName
{
background-image:url("../Images/brandlobby/search_by_name_bg.gif");
width:170px;
height:161px;
float: left;
position: relative;
margin-left: 140px;
.margin: 0px;
margin-top: 5px;
overflow:hidden;
top:50px;
left: 650px;	
.left: 648px;
font-family:Verdana;
font-size:13px;
color:#444343;
}

.float
{
	float:left;
}


div.descDivCss
{
 
}

.searchdiv
{
	margin-top:5px;
}

.WorldMapDivPins
{
	width: 370px;
	float:right;
	height: 161px;
	position:relative;
	margin-left: 2px;
	left: -249px;
	.left: -350px;
	top: -160px;
	.top: -270px;
}


.UpperDiv
{
	height: 70px; 
	margin-top:10px;
	margin-left:10px;
}

.subUpperDiv
{
	margin-top:10px;
	margin-left:10px;
}

.searchBoxInput
{
	border: solid 1px Gray;
	width:148px;
	height:18px;
}

.smallPicDivStyle
{
	clear:both;
	width: 1000px; 
	/*margin-left:5px;*/
}
.smallPicInExDivStyle
{
	width: 480px; 
	float: left;
	/*margin-left:5px;*/
}

.setButtonInputPos
{
	margin-top:10px; 
	padding-left:116px;
}

.mainPageDiv
{
}



.setFormPos
{
	margin-right:52px;
	  _margin-left:-123px;
	  .margin-right:42px;
	  
	height:205px;
}

.mar5
{
	margin-left:10px;
}

.setSearchInputsPos1
{
	margin-bottom:10px; 
	margin-left:10px;
	.margin-left:5px;
	font-family:Verdana;
	font-size:13px;
	color:#444343;
	float:left;
	
}
	
.setSearchInputsPos2
{
	margin-left:10px;
	.margin-left:5px;
	float:left;
}

.setSearchInputsPos3
{
	margin-left:10px;
	.margin-left:5px;
	 float:left;
}

.setButtonInputPos
{
	
	margin-left:6px;
}

.brandsHeaderFont
{
	margin:0px; 
	font-size:13px; 
	font-family:Verdana; 
	color:#444343;
}

.subUpperDiv h1 span
{
	font-size:13px;
}


.brandsPopUp
{
	width:300px;
	height:100px;
	background-color:#F3F3F3;
	position:absolute;
	.position:relative;
	border:2px solid black;
	left:260px;
	bottom:20px;
	.bottom:100px;
	padding-right:5px;
	padding-left:5px;
}

.popUptitle
{
	font-family:Verdana;
	font-size:13px;
	color:#666666;
	width:290px;
}

.imgMark
{
	float:right;
	margin-right:30px;
	margin-top:20px;
}

.cancelAnswer
{
	float:right;
	margin-top:25px;
	margin-right:40px;
}

.okAnswer
{
	float:right;
	margin-top:25px;
	margin-right:40px;
}

.noBrandsFoundDiv
{
	position:relative;
	font-family:Verdana;
	font-size:13px;
	color:#666666;
	left:670px;
	top:-150px;
}


/******************Start Of Brand Page*********************/
.moreLinks
{
	margin-top:15px;
	font-size:13px;
	font-family:Verdana;
	float:left;
	width:446px;
}

.moreLogos
{
	float:left;
	width:350px;
	overflow:visible;
}

.logosImage
{
	float:left;
	margin-left:20px;
}



.FormHeaderStyle
{
	font-size:14px;
	font-family:Verdana;
	font-weight:bold;
	color:#F08523;
	padding-top:20px;
	margin-left:20px;
}


.rowInformSection
{
	margin-left:20px;
	padding-bottom:15px;
	margin-top:22px;
	clear:both;
	font-family:Verdana;
	font-size:13px;
	color:#666666;
}

.InputNamesWidth
{
	width:80px;
	text-align:left;
}

.sendButtonPos
{
	margin-left : 435px;	
	.margin-left : 452px;	
}

.linkToCampaign
{
	font-size:13px;
	font-family:Verdana;
	color:#666666;
	font-weight:bold;
}

.DivErrMsg
{
	font-family : Verdana ;
	font-size : 9px;
	color : red;
	width : 50px;		
	height:10px;
	position:relative;
}

/*Brand form input positions*/
.inputNamePos
{
	top:90px;
	font-family : Verdana ;
	font-size : 9px;
	color : red;
	border-left : 1px solid  #e6e6e6; 
	border-right  : 1px solid  #e6e6e6; 
	height:10px;
	_height:13px;
	position:relative;
	margin-left : 100px;
	.margin-left : 120px;

}

.inputRegionPos
{
	font-family : Verdana ;
	font-size : 9px;
	color : red;
	border-left : 1px solid  #e6e6e6; 
	border-right  : 1px solid  #e6e6e6; 
	height:10px;
	_height:13px;
	position:relative;
	margin-left : 100px;
	top:164px;
	.margin-left : 120px;
}

.inputEmailPos
{
	font-family : Verdana ;
	font-size : 9px;
	color : red;
	border-left : 1px solid  #e6e6e6; 
	border-right  : 1px solid  #e6e6e6; 
	height:10px;
	_height:13px;
	position:relative;
	margin-left : 100px;
	top:126px;
	.top:127px;
	.margin-left : 120px;
}

.inputContentPos
{
	font-family : Verdana ;
	font-size : 9px;
	color : red;
	border-left : 1px solid  #e6e6e6; 
	border-right  : 1px solid  #e6e6e6; 
	width : 878px;		
	height:10px;
	_height:13px;
	position:relative;
	margin-left : 100px;
	top:274px;
	.top:267px;
	.margin-left : 120px;
}

.formSection
{
	padding-bottom:10px;
}

.brandPageWarper
{
	 padding-left: 36px;
	 float:left;
	 width:964px;
}

.categoryWarpDiv
{
	float:left;
	width:430px;
	padding-right:45px;
	padding-bottom:10px;
	margin-top:15px;
}

.categotyBubeLink img
{
    padding-left :15px;
    padding-top:10px;
}

.categotyBubeLink
{
	float:left;
	padding-right:10px;
	padding-bottom:10px;
	
	width:130px;
	height:130px;
	text-align:center;
	vertical-align:middle;

}

.categotyBubeLink a
{
    cursor:pointer;
}


#linkofmore
{
	font-family:Verdana;
	font-size:13px;
}

.categoryWarpDiv
{
	font-family:Verdana;
	font-size:13px;
}

/*Brand PopUp*/
.popUpBrandImageDiv
{
	float:left;
	margin-top:30px;
	width:65px;
	height:65px;
	
}

.popUpBrandTitle
{
	float:left;
	font-family:Verdana;
	font-size:16px;
	font-weight:bold;
	color:#444343;
	margin-top:46px;
	text-align:left;
	margin-left:40px;
	_margin-left:20px;
	width:200px;
}

.popUpBrandImage
{
	
}

.popUpDivSizes
{
	display:none; 
}

.showBrandsPopUp
{
	
	width:280px;
    float:left;
	border:1px solid black;
	background-color:White;
	display:block; 
	background-repeat:repeat-x;
	position:relative;
	min-height: 370px;
	max-height: 450px;
	top: -130px;
	z-index:1;
}

.showBrandsPopUp Div
{
	_background-repeat:no-repeat;
	

}

.popUpBrandDescription
{
	font-size:13px;
	font-family:Arial;
	color:#666666;
	text-align:center;
	/*margin-left:26px;*/
	width:auto;
}

.BottompopUpBrandImage
{
	padding-top:0px!important;
	margin:0px 0px 0px 0px;
}

.externalLink
{
	font-size:13px;
	font-family:Verdana;
	margin-left:28px;
	text-align:left;
	padding-bottom:10px;
	padding-top:10px;
	float:left;
	
}

#facebox .footer
{
  padding-top: 5px;
  margin-top: -33px;
  margin-right:20px;
  text-align: right;
}  

/*End Brand PopUp*/

/******************End Of Brand Page*********************/
.thumbnailContent
{
	width:200px;
	overflow:hidden;
	height:400px;
	width:356px;
}

.popUpLobbyTitle
{
	font-family:Verdana;
	font-size:16px;
	font-weight:bold;
	float:left;
	margin-left:35px;
	margin-top:67px;
}

.popUpLobbyImage
{
	float:left;
	margin-left:180px;
	margin-top:20px;
}

.brandRegionClass
{
	font-size:13px;
	font-family:Verdana;
	font-weight:bold;
	color:#444343;
}
.brandRegionWarp
{
	float:left;
	margin-left:30px;
}

.brandGroupClass
{
	font-size:13px;
	font-family:Verdana;
	font-weight:bold;
	color:#444343;
}

.spaceInPopUp
{
	clear:both;
	height:25px;
}

.brandGroupWarp
{
	float:left;
	margin-left:80px;
	
}

.BrandProdClass
{
	clear:both;
	font-size:13px;
	font-family:Verdana;
	font-weight:bold;
	color:#444343;
	margin-top:70px;
	.margin-top:10px;
	margin-left:30px;
}

.CountiesOfBrandClass
{
	margin-left:-23px;
	margin-top:-10px;
}

.title_Coffie
{
	color:#994708
}

.title_Everyday
{
	color:#E20A16;
}

.title_health
{
	color:#3799C4;
}

.closeButtonClass
{
	margin-left:30px;
	margin-top:15px;
	float:left;
}
.popUpLinkToBrand
{
	float:left;
	margin-left:115px;
	margin-top:15px;
}


.popUpdottedLine
{
	height:3px;
	width:360;
	border-bottom:1px dotted black;
}

.brandProdChildClass
{
	height:50px;
}

.cubeImageClass
{
	margin-top:3px;
}

.popUpDescriotion
{
	clear:both;
	margin-left:26px;
	font-family:Verdana;
	font-size:12px;
	color:#ffffff;
	margin-top:92px;
	.margin-top:10px;
	height:100px;
	width:307px;
}

.childrenLiClass
{
	float:left;
	margin-left:45px;
	.margin-left:20px;
	margin-top:3px;
	width:80px;
	font-family:Verdana;
	font-size:12px;
	color:#666666;
}

.childrenLiClass li
{	
	list-style-image:url('../Images/rect.jpg');
	height:17px;
}

.CountiesOfBrandClass ul li
{
	list-style-image:url('../Images/rect.jpg');
	height:17px;
}

.onlyHebIESet
{
	/*margin-left:10px;*/
}
.Margin5
{
    margin-left:5px;
}
.setBrandHeightExternal
{

}

/*******Thank you box***********/

div.ThankyouImage
{
	background-image : url('../Images/pic_popup.jpg');
	background-repeat:no-repeat ;
	height : 150px;
	margin-left : 10px;
	margin-top : 10px;
}


div.ThankyouHeader
{
	font-family : Verdana ;
	font-size : 16px;
	margin-top : -150px; 
	margin-left : 220px;
	color : #a64d07;
	font-weight : bold ;
}

div.ThankyouText
{
	width : 600px;
	margin-left : 220px;
	padding-top : 20px;
	font-size:13px;
	color:#444343;	
	height:100px;
}

.PropPicDescription
{
	margin-left:-36px;
}


.iconsWarper
{
	float:left;
	padding-left:10px;
	height:120px;
	_overflow: visible;
}

.iconsImage
{
	cursor:pointer;
}

.partnersBrandsLine
{
	margin-left:5px;
	float:left;
}

.closeButtonPopup
{
	cursor:pointer;
	font-size:13px;
	font-family:Verdana;
	text-align:left;
	margin-top:15px;
	float:right;
	margin-right:10px;
	padding-bottom:10px;
}

.brandPageUnderConstruction
{
	text-align:center;
	font-family:Verdana;
	font-size:14px;
	color:#666666;
	font-weight:bold;
	margin-top:50px;
}

.ourBrandTitleZone1
{
	text-align:center;
	font-family:Verdana;
	font-size:14px;
	font-weight:bold;
	color:#2A8EBB;
}

.ourBrandTitleZone2
{
	text-align:center;
	font-family:Verdana;
	font-size:14px;
	font-weight:bold;
	color:#F58926;
}

.BrandsFrame
{
	width:336px;
	height:304px;
	.height:300px;
}
.bottomPopUpImage
{
   padding-top:10px;
   text-align:center;
}

.categoryItemWarp
{
    
   
    width : 440px;
    padding-bottom :10px; 
        
}

.bottomPopupWarp
{
    	
}

.dottedLinePopUp
{
	height:1px;
	margin-right:5px;
	margin-left:5px;
	border-top:1px dotted #666666;
}

.popUpsep
{
	clear:both;
	height:20px;
}

.brandNamePopUp
{
	font-size:15px;
	
	/*color:#ffffff;*/
	font-weight:bold;
	clear:both;
	padding-bottom:10px;
	/*padding-top:20px;*/
	/*margin-left:40px;*/
	text-align:center;
}


/*Disclamer*/
.disclamerInput
{
	float:left;
}

.disclamerInput input
{
	border:0px;
}

.disclamerWarp
{
	clear:both;
	width:350px;
	margin-left:20px;
	margin-top:10px;
}

.disclamer
{
	float:left;
	font-family:Verdana;
	font-size:12px;
	color:#444343;
	width:320px;
	margin-left:10px;
}

.disclamerError
{
	font-family:Verdana;
	font-size:12px;
	color:red;
}


/* New Icon */ 
.iconNewClass
{
	position:absolute;
	margin-right:-5px;
	margin-top:-35px;
}

.width342
{
	width:378px;
}
.moreLinksBold, .moreLinksBold a:link, .moreLinksBold a:hover, .moreLinksBold a:visited
{
	font-family: Verdana;
	font-weight: bold;
	font-size: 14px;
	/*color: #666666;*/
}
.FBLikeBtn
{
    float:right;
    border:medium none;
    height:21px;
    overflow:hidden;
    padding-right:70px;
    
}